Patents Examined by Benjamin Smith
-
Patent number: 11755818Abstract: A non-transitory computer-readable recording medium stores a design document management program causing a computer to execute a process including: acquiring a plurality of design documents about a system; identifying a plurality of label items representing elements of the system based on appearance frequency information of character strings included in the plurality of design documents acquired; and generating structure information in which the plurality of label items are hierarchized based on appearance positions at which the character string corresponding to each of the plurality of label items identified appears in the plurality of design documents.Type: GrantFiled: October 15, 2021Date of Patent: September 12, 2023Assignee: FUJITSU LIMITEDInventor: Shigenori Inoue
-
Patent number: 11734268Abstract: Disclosed are methods, systems, devices, apparatus, media, design structures, and other implementations, including a method that includes receiving a source document, applying one or more pre-processes to the source document to produce contextual information representative of the structure and content of the source document, and transforming the source document, based on the contextual information, to generate a question-and-answer searchable document.Type: GrantFiled: June 25, 2021Date of Patent: August 22, 2023Assignee: Pryon IncorporatedInventors: David Nahamoo, Igor Roditis Jablokov, Vaibhava Goel, Etienne Marcheret, Ellen Eide Kislal, Steven John Rennie, Marie Wenzel Meteer, Neil Rohit Mallinar, Soonthorn Ativanichayaphong, Joseph Allen Pruitt, John Pruitt, Bryan Dempsey, Chui Sung
-
Patent number: 11727065Abstract: The present disclosure provides systems and methods for retaining bookmarks of a first document when a second document is saved using the first name of the first document. Upon receiving a request to save the second document using the first name, it is determined whether another document is saved using that particular name. If such a document exists, properties of bookmarks associated with the first document are compared to properties of the second document using a set of rules. If the set of rules are satisfied, indicating that the bookmarks are usable, then the second document is stored using the first name while retaining the bookmarks of the first document.Type: GrantFiled: March 19, 2021Date of Patent: August 15, 2023Assignee: SAP SEInventors: Nikita Jain, Devashish Biswas
-
Patent number: 11726635Abstract: The present disclosure describes methods and systems for interpreting a table grouping input value associated with a table, wherein the table comprises a plurality of categories and a plurality of associated data sets corresponding to the plurality of categories, determining an aggregation value in response to the table grouping input value, wherein the aggregation value corresponds to at least one of the plurality of categories, and in response to the aggregation value, providing an aggregated table view.Type: GrantFiled: March 16, 2021Date of Patent: August 15, 2023Assignee: Coda Project, Inc.Inventors: Melissa Ming-Sak Boucher, Jeremy Edward Britton, Luke Bayes, Monica F. Caso, Alexander W. Deneui, Christopher Leland Eck, Nigel Robin Ellis, Filipe P. Fortes, David Lilja Greenspan, Brett Robert Hobbs, Matthew B. Hudson, Timothy Andrew James, Kenneth Francis Mendes, Shishir S. Mehrotra, Trevor Michael O'Brien, Lane Patrick Shackleton, Rhed Shi, Hariharan Sivaramakrishnan, Jason Peter Stowe, Jason Andrew Tamulonis, Himanshu Vasishth, Ramesh Krishna Vyaghrapuri, David Richard Wright, Irvin Zhan, Roger Mathieu Zurawicki
-
Patent number: 11727202Abstract: A system and method for electronic signature validation is provided. Embodiments may include initiating, using a computing device, an online notarization meeting between a signer and an agent and displaying, at a graphical user interface, a first electronic document associated with the online notarization meeting. Embodiments may also include allowing, at the graphical user interface, one or more edits to the first electronic document to generate a partially completed first electronic document and displaying, at the graphical user interface, a user selectable option to lock the partially completed first electronic document. In response to receiving a selection of the user selectable option, embodiments may further include storing the partially completed first electronic document. Embodiment may further include determining that the online notarization meeting has been interrupted and recovering, after the interruption, the partially completed first electronic document.Type: GrantFiled: October 23, 2018Date of Patent: August 15, 2023Assignee: Notarize, Inc.Inventors: Rhan Kathleen Kim, Alexander James Jenkins, Russell Morton, Arturo Gonzalez, II, Raynor Joseph Kuang, Nicholas Guo Ying Teo
-
Facilitating dynamic document layout by determining reading order using document content stream cues
Patent number: 11714953Abstract: Disclosed systems and methods determine a reading order of an electronic document. In an example, a document processing application accesses a content stream that includes a first object with a first location within the electronic document, a second object with a second location within the electronic document, and a third object with a third location within the electronic document. The application computes a region that includes the first object and the second object by determining that the second object is adjacent to the first object in a first dimension, at least a portion of the first and second objects are aligned in a second dimension, and the boundaries of the region do not intersect or encompass the third object. Based on the objects in the region, the application determines that a reading order should include the first object and the second object and should exclude the third object.Type: GrantFiled: October 27, 2021Date of Patent: August 1, 2023Assignee: ADOBE INC.Inventor: Ram Bhushan Agrawal -
Patent number: 11687604Abstract: Provided are systems and methods for personalizing website content configured for delivery to a user. An exemplary system includes a graph database for storage of data (i) representative of the user's interaction with existing content presented on the website and (ii) indicative of content entities of interest to the user, the data being stored as nodes. Also included are one or more personalization engines configured to analyze relations between one or more pairs of the nodes, each analyzed relation creating a respective link, and a structure of each of the links being a function of the user's interaction with the existing content. The one or more processors are configured to personalize new content for presentation to the user and a portion of the new content is (i) derived from one of the respective links and (ii) delivered to the user in near-real time when a type of the first link is within a first category.Type: GrantFiled: August 12, 2019Date of Patent: June 27, 2023Inventors: York Eggleston, IV, Llewellyn Wall
-
Patent number: 11645478Abstract: Introduced here is an approach to translating tags assigned to digital images. As an example, embeddings may be extracted from a tag to be translated and the digital image with which the tag is associated by a multimodal model. These embeddings can be compared to embeddings extracted from a set of target tags associated with a target language by the multimodal model. Such an approach allows similarity to be established along two dimensions, which ensures the obstacles associated with direct translation can be avoided.Type: GrantFiled: November 4, 2020Date of Patent: May 9, 2023Assignee: Adobe Inc.Inventors: Ritiz Tambi, Pranav Aggarwal, Ajinkya Kale
-
Patent number: 11640419Abstract: Systems, methods, and software described herein provide enhancements of managing summaries provided to end users. In one implementation, a summary service provides a user with identifier for a plurality of events, and obtains a selection from the user, wherein the selection identifies a first type of summary for an event in the plurality of events. The summary service further provides the user with a first summary of the first type for the event, identifies one or more suggested types of summaries for the event based at least in part on data points for the event, and provides the one or more suggested types of summaries to the user.Type: GrantFiled: October 22, 2018Date of Patent: May 2, 2023Assignee: Primer Technologies, Inc.Inventors: Sean William-Joseph Gourley, Leonard Apeltsin, Amy Heineike, Emmanuel Ramon Yera, John Neil Bohannon
-
Patent number: 11636407Abstract: In response to a request received from a client device to view an item, a program determines a category associated with the item and a location associated with a user of the client device. The program also identifies a form based on the category and the location. The form comprises a set of fields. The program then provides a graphical user interface (GUI) that includes the form to the client device. The program also receives, through the GUI, data values for the set of fields from the client device and a request to add the item to a collection of items. The program then identifies a policy based on the category and the location. The program also applies the policy to the data values for the set of fields. The program then sends a notification to the client device indicating a result of the application of the policy.Type: GrantFiled: September 17, 2021Date of Patent: April 25, 2023Assignee: SAP SEInventors: Yuan Tung, Lalitha Rajagopalan, Sudhir Bhojwani, Payod Deshpande, Pranay Kaikini, Raghavendra Keshavamurthy
-
Patent number: 11630958Abstract: The disclosure herein describes determining topics of communication transcripts using trained summarization models. A first communication transcript associated with a first communication is obtained and divided into a first set of communication segments. A first set of topic descriptions is generated based on the first set of communication segments by analyzing each communication segment of the first set of communication segments with a generative language model. A summarization model is trained using the first set of communication segments and associated first set of topic descriptions as training data. The trained summarization model is then applied to a second communication transcript and, based on applying the trained summarization model to the second communication transcript, a second set of topic descriptions of the second communication transcript is generated.Type: GrantFiled: June 2, 2021Date of Patent: April 18, 2023Assignee: Microsoft Technology Licensing, LLCInventors: Royi Ronen, Yarin Kuper, Tomer Rosenthal, Abedelkader Asi, Erez Altus, Rona Shaanan
-
Patent number: 11625527Abstract: A computer-implemented method interfaces with a remote attachment from a spreadsheet program on a client device. A first area in the spreadsheet associates with a top-level object in a web server, and a second area associates with a descendant object. On a first user interaction with a cell in the second area, a user interface item is shown, allowing uploading and/or downloading the attachment. When the user interacts to upload or download, the program uploads (or queues for upload) a selected attachment and modifies attachment metadata in the second area, or downloads the attachment based on attachment metadata in the second area. Communication between the spreadsheet program and the web server may be REST compliant.Type: GrantFiled: November 17, 2021Date of Patent: April 11, 2023Assignee: Oracle International CorporationInventors: Kelsey Von Tish, Edmund Alex Davis
-
Patent number: 11615234Abstract: A method including receiving information pertaining to a client entity; storing the information in a database; receiving, from a user interface of an application communicatively coupled to the database, a first selection to perform a first task; determining, based on the first task, a first subset of document templates to populate from a plurality of document templates; retrieving the first subset of document templates from the database; populating the first subset of document templates using the information pertaining to the client entity to generate a first populated subset of documents; and performing the first task using the first populated subset of documents.Type: GrantFiled: October 16, 2020Date of Patent: March 28, 2023Inventor: Bradley W. Grosse
-
Patent number: 11615237Abstract: The present disclosure provides a processing method for presenting an indicator hierarchy and classification of data in a spreadsheet. In this method, an indicator index structure S is constructed and a spreadsheet is used to present information based on user selections. The information includes an indicator and a hierarchy of the indicator, an indicator classification description and a hierarchy of the indicator classification description, an application scenario between an indicator and an indicator classification description, and other implicit attributes. This way, indicator descriptions can be neater and more readable. Data in a two-dimensional spreadsheet can be accurately presented and the spreadsheet is more comprehensible. In addition, indicators and indicator classification descriptions can be flexibly combined to present data in a more diversified, flexible, and personalized manner.Type: GrantFiled: March 25, 2022Date of Patent: March 28, 2023Inventors: Yinsheng Li, Feng Wu, Chaozong Zhang, Yongchuan Nie, Hong Wang, Yan Ren, Miao Liu, Jinlong Zhang, Juan Chen, Die Zhang, Qiannan Jiang, Cong Zhang, Yuan Gao, Yinzhen Gao, Pengjie Wu
-
Patent number: 11580297Abstract: Embodiments as disclosed provide a What-You-See-Is-What-You Get (WYSIWYG) editor for web content, allowing the conversion of previously generated web content to reusable templates or components. Embodiments thus allow, among other advantages, users such as web content developers to easily repurpose or reuse previously developed pages or content by giving these users the ability to review and edit previously developed pages or content in a WYSIWYG editor.Type: GrantFiled: December 7, 2021Date of Patent: February 14, 2023Assignee: OPEN TEXT CORPORATIONInventors: John W. Chang, Paul Kieron Carl Narth, Sampada Khare, Sunil Menon
-
Patent number: 11562134Abstract: A system and method for advanced document redaction are disclosed. According to one embodiment, a system comprises a parser that analyzes documents to identify structured, semi-structured, and unstructured data from a document. A candidates generator generates a list of words for redaction from the structured, semi-structured, and unstructured data. A replacement engine replaces one or more words from the list of words with one or more of a replacement word, random characters, and random numbers.Type: GrantFiled: April 2, 2019Date of Patent: January 24, 2023Assignee: Genpact Luxembourg S.à r.l. IIInventor: Shishir Mane
-
Patent number: 11544446Abstract: According to some embodiments, methods and systems may include a data storage device that contains document files associated with a plurality of document line objects with attributes, the attributes including item terms and conditions. An object exchange platform processor may receive input values for a selected document line object with attributes and determine that the selected document line object contains multiple object sets. The processor may then create, for each object set, a separate executable outline document having an outline document identifier. The processor may also arrange to establish the plurality of executable outline documents at a remote external central component platform. According to some embodiments, objects within the selected document line object have a hierarchical structure such that some objects are sub-items of other objects.Type: GrantFiled: November 29, 2018Date of Patent: January 3, 2023Assignee: SAP SEInventors: Prasanna Kumar Govindappa, Debashis Banerjee, Hari Babu Krishnan, Shruthi Jinadatta, Santhosh Krishnamurthy, Sagar Mullanghi
-
Patent number: 11537272Abstract: In an illustrative embodiment, methods and systems for integrating web content generated by a content management system (CMS) with dynamic content generated by a content development system include an API handler of the CMS configured to communicate an action received from a remote computing device to a web part, where the web part interfaces with both the CMS and a web application framework to coordinate response to the action and to inject information regarding the dynamic content into the web content for use by the remote computing device. The remote computing device may include a view provider module configured to access the dynamic content using the injected information.Type: GrantFiled: December 19, 2017Date of Patent: December 27, 2022Assignee: AON GLOBAL OPERATIONS SE, SINGAPORE BRANCHInventors: Anthony Dunne, Niall Toal, Remo Jansen
-
Patent number: 11537669Abstract: Techniques prepare a document for electronic signing. Such techniques involve identifying a set of signature fields common within the document, the set being for use with different pages of the document. Such techniques further involve, in response to identifying the set of signature fields, modifying content of the different pages to include the set of signature fields. Such techniques further involve outputting a prepared version of the document that includes the modified content of the different pages of the document.Type: GrantFiled: June 9, 2021Date of Patent: December 27, 2022Assignee: Citrix Systems, Inc.Inventors: Manbinder Pal Singh, Maanusri Balasubramanian
-
Patent number: 11526391Abstract: An ordered set of root cause analysis (RCA) document entry criteria is identified. RCA input segments are specified using unstructured natural language input, including at least: incident descriptive elements, a single problem statement, a set of why questions and answers, and a single cause categorization. A guided input sequence of the RCA input segments is performed interactively with a user. Quality indicators of content of user input entered during a respective RCA input segment are determined using a scoring algorithm, and the user is assisted with improving precision and consistency of the user input. Responsive to a threshold of consistent user input across the RCA input segments resulting in identification of a single cause categorization of an information technology (IT) problem, an RCA document is generated that identifies the single cause categorization of the new IT problem.Type: GrantFiled: September 9, 2019Date of Patent: December 13, 2022Assignee: Kyndryl, Inc.Inventors: Zoltan Dobos, Alan Piciacchio, Ivan Peter Orlik, Attila Sasvari, Angela Hillenbrand, Christopher Tobey